Francesco Bagnaia’s journey to becoming Ducati’s talisman has been one marked by persistence, determination, and undeniable talent. Born in Turin, Italy, Bagnaia began his racing career at a young age and quickly became one of the brightest prospects in the MotoGP paddock. His early years in the lower categories of motorcycle racing showcased his potential, but it was his move to Ducati in the MotoGP class that truly transformed him into a world-class competitor.
After winning the Moto2 World Championship in 2018, Bagnaia made his debut in MotoGP with the Pramac Racing team, Ducati’s satellite outfit, in 2019. While his rookie season had its ups and downs, Bagnaia showed flashes of brilliance that hinted at his future success. By 2021, Bagnaia had joined the factory Ducati team, and it was during this season that he established himself as a serious title contender. With multiple race wins and a string of podium finishes, Bagnaia closed the gap on his rivals and ultimately became a legitimate threat for the championship.
In 2022, Bagnaia’s hard work and dedication paid off when he claimed his first MotoGP World Championship. His championship-winning season was a masterclass in consistency and skill, as he fought off intense competition to bring Ducati their first rider’s title since Casey Stoner’s triumph in 2007. Bagnaia’s success in 2022 not only secured his place in the sport’s history books but also further cemented his role as Ducati’s undisputed number-one rider.
